Ecological Engineers in Pinehill Acres Deerfield Beach, FL
1. Miami Environmental
4540 NW 8th Ter, Fort Lauderdale, FL 33309
3. Environmental Consulting & Technology Inc
550 W Cypress Creek Rd, Fort Lauderdale, FL 33309
CLOSED NOW:
Showing 1-3 of 3
4540 NW 8th Ter, Fort Lauderdale, FL 33309
550 W Cypress Creek Rd, Fort Lauderdale, FL 33309
Showing 1-3 of 3